    Cranston delivers a titanic fill-the-screen turn, capturing the man’s bombast and sincerity in equal measure. In the process, he dwarfs his castmates.... Though it presents a captivating look at the nuts and bolts of high-stakes politicking, it suffers in such inevitable comparisons, in part because Roach’s direction is so stifling that the film feels small at the very moments it should be grand.

    The film version of Cranston's LBJ only comes to life when he's listening to other characters or silently brooding to himself (while voice-over narration articulates his fears and doubts); otherwise he's a Madam Tussaud's waxworks LBJ that can move and speak, a testament to latex craftsmanship and the careful study of newsreels. The bigger his LBJ is in this film, the less credible and interesting he is.
